Student ID card
You must obtain a Student ID card from the University in order to fully complete the registration process, failure to do so may result in your registration with the University being terminated. Your Student ID card, which remains the property of the University of Leeds at all times, is your key to the University and as such it:
- identifies you as a student of the University of Leeds
- allows you to use the University Union (subject to Union regulations)
- is your University Library Card - you will need it to enter Library buildings
- provides you with access to University Computing facilities (through Information Systems Services)
- allows you to use Sport and Physical Activity facilities (if you choose to join and pay the fee)
Your Student ID card will last for the duration of your study at the University. If you change your programme, and this has an impact on the duration of your study, you should obtain a new card (prior to the expiry of your current card) from the Student Services Centre Counter, Level 9, Marjorie & Arnold Ziff Building.
Fraudulent use of a Student ID card will be subject to action under the University Disciplinary Procedure. Such action may involve not only the perpetrator of the fraud but also the student whose card is involved if it can be shown that the student was culpable (for example if the card has been lent).

What to do if you lose your Student ID card
If you lose your Student ID card, you should go to the Student Services Centre Counter (Level 9, Marjorie & Arnold Ziff Building) to order a replacement Card for which there is a charge (non-refundable and payable with order). You will need to provide photographic identification (such as driving licence or passport) when requesting a replacement Student ID Card. If you require a replacement Student ID card during Registration Week (19-23 September 2011) you can obtain one from the Student Services Centre Counter.
